Hi, I have a fairly large gwt that is using a large number of libraries. To ensure there are no unwanted dependencies i am trying to split my project into 3 modules client (everything ui related), server (server processing related) and rpc (All my bussiness objects). both client and server inherit from rpc.
The problem i have encountered is declaring the servlet in the gwt.xml config files (of which there are 3, one for each module). I am getting ClassNotFound exceptions. I dont want to inherit the server module in the client and according to the GWT diagrams i shouldnt need to. Is splitting the RPC section of my project possible and if so any help would be greatly appreciated.
